This prawn and saffron risotto is a guided recipe from the second chip and cookbook “cooking for me and you”. Very simple to follow, never used saffron before so I was excited to taste it. Now I wouldn’t say the risotto was a fail but I’m sure serious foodies would. Because I doubled the quantity of rice and prawns, I decided to double the cooking time which in hindsight was way too long- increased from 13 mins to 26 mins. The risotto is a little thick and probably only needed 20 mins. So used to setting the thernomix and forgetting that I didn’t even think to check through the lid with the consistency as any good cook would do if they were stirring over a stovetop. The flavour is still good and nobody was complaining that it was too thick. It was still gobbled up. Probably didn’t need to double the recipe, we have enough risotto to feed about 10 people.
